From: Impairment of brain endothelial glucose transporter by methamphetamine causes blood-brain barrier dysfunction

Figure 2

Effect of METH on GLUT1 expression in hBEC. (A) Immunocytochemical expression of GLUT1 (green) merged with von Willebrand factor (vWF, red) and DAPI (blue) in hBECs. (B) Effect of METH (20 μM and 200 μM) on 55 kDa isoform GLUT1 protein levels in hBEC lysate protein with different co-treatments for 24 hr. (C) Effect of METH (20 μM) on 55 kDa isoform GLUT1 protein levels in hBEC lysate protein with different time periods and compared with 72 hr control cells. Both bar graphs show the results, which are expressed as ratio of GLUT1 to that of α-actin bands and presented as the mean values (± SEM; n = 5). *p < 0.05, **p < 0.01 statistically significant compared with controls. Scale bar indicates 40 μm in the panels of A.
